| 0:30.7 | Hello, and welcome to Matt Delia is confused. |
| 0:34.0 | This is Matt Delia. |
| 0:36.0 | And this week's guest is a culture critic named John Semley. |
| 0:40.0 | John wrote a book called Hater on the virtues of utter disagreeability, a book I read, and a book I loved, and a book that I felt such a deep kinship with that I wanted to have its |
| 0:57.3 | writer on as a guest to discuss its subjects and that writer is John Semley and yeah I think this |
| 1:08.8 | this episode was great I mean I we touch on a lot of things that I care a lot about and think a lot about |
| 1:17.6 | just sort of on my own and I've been called a hater at various times in my life and I've always sort of been not so much bothered by that but I found it curious because in my own mind I just |
| 1:39.8 | think I have strong opinions about things If I don't like them I'm liable to hate them and if I do like them I'm liable to love them. |
| 1:50.8 | But I don't think of myself as someone who just knee-jerk hates things and I certainly don't want to hate things. |
| 1:56.0 | I go to things wanting to like them. |
| 1:59.0 | It's not my fault that they fucking suck. |
